Assistant Security Coordinator is a uniformed position that supports the Security Coordinator in leading the day-to-day departmental operations and supervising the on-duty security operations team in a 24/7 security operation. The Assistant Security Coordinator assists in ensuring operational targets are met, security services are delivered professionally, and customer service standards are maintained. They play a key role in resource deployment, facilitating effective communication, supporting decision-making, and managing operations as directed by the Security Coordinator. In the event of an absence in the Security Coordinator role, the Assistant Security Coordinator will be required to step in and fully assume those responsibilities for the duration of the shift.Organizational Status
The Assistant Security Coordinator supports the Security Coordinator daily in overseeing overall operations, and provides leadership to teams of Patrol Officers during critical events and proceedings that take place on campus. In the event that the Security Coordinator is absent, the Assistant Security Coordinator steps in to fulfill that role.Work Performed-Supervises, organizes and allocates the work of an assigned team of Patrol Officers on duty and during major events on campus that require dedicated oversight and security presence.– Assists the Security Coordinator to provide direction and guidance to , and helps to ensure operations are running according to policies/procedures.– Liaises with Security Coordinator and relevant stakeholders in the provision of special projects that support departmental objectives and improved problem solving. Actively solicits ideas and opinions from others to efficiently and effectively accomplish strategic objectives. Troubleshoots and investigates issues, and solicits multiple sources of advice prior to taking action when appropriate.– Communicates key objectives and tasks to front-line staff as directed by the Security Coordinator.– Leads by example and provides guidance through active participation in patrols and the daily assigned tasks and responsibilities carried out by patrol officers.– Assists in resource deployment, ensuring operational needs are met and service delivery aligns with departmental standards and the expectations of the UBC community.– Responds to critical incidents and high priority/sensitive tasks, taking a leadership role during situations and escalating issues to the Security Coordinator, or to appropriate campus partners or external stakeholders as needed.– Reviews incident reports and shift logs to identify issues or trends and provides feedback or recommendations to improve team performance.– Supports event operations by assisting with staff deployment, ensuring proper coverage, providing event-specific training, and supporting the execution of event plans.– Upholds departmental standards by supporting the adherence to uniform policies, maintaining cleanliness of vehicles and equipment, and promoting a professional image.– Supports team development through coaching and mentoring, encouraging professionalism, and promoting a collaborative environment.– Supports the delivery of first aid and safety services in accordance with Occupational First Aid Advanced certification, ensuring compliance with health and safety standards.– Works with patrol team to maintain equipment, ensuring functionality, addressing issues as they arise, and reporting or mitigating concerns in collaboration with the Security Coordinator or management.– Provides assistance, direction, and information to the UBC community and external partners while building and maintaining positive relationships.– Monitors and addresses unauthorized or suspicious activities to ensure campus safety; reports to management or external agencies as necessary.
